Profile
My research interests include development and improvement of seismic exploration methods to accurately characterize and monitor geothermal reservoirs, reservoirs for CO2 geological storages, and shallow subsurface structures for predicting earthquake ground shaking.

Educational Activities

  • I am in charge of foundational lectures and experimental courses in Geophysical Exploration, with a focus on helping students acquire both theoretical knowledge and practical skills. In particular, I incorporate programming-based activities into the lecture, providing students with opportunities to apply learned theories to actual problems through hands-on practice.

    For senior undergraduate students as well as those in the master’s and doctoral programs, I provide individualized research supervision tailored to each student’s research theme. Daily discussions are emphasized to encourage students to identify and define their own research problems, and to think critically and independently throughout the research process. My aim is to support their development into independent researchers by fostering their logical thinking and problem-solving abilities.

Outline of Social Contribution and International Cooperation activities

  • In the SATREPS project titled “Comprehensive Solutions for Optimal Development of Geothermal Systems in the East African Rift Valley”, I am responsible for conducting geophysical surveys of geothermal resources in Kenya. I also provide hands-on training to Kenyan researchers on the operation and application of geophysical equipment used on-site, thereby contributing to local capacity building and technology transfer. In addition, I deliver lectures on seismic exploration at geothermal workshops held in Kenya.

    As part of the JICA Knowledge Co-Creation Program titled “Geothermal Resource Engineers”, I am also in charge of project-based studies on seismic exploration, supporting the development of technical expertise among engineers from developing countries.
